titleOfInvention |
Process for making cephem derivatives |
abstract |
A process for preparing B-lactam derivatives of the formula (I): (I) wherein R1 represents hydrogen or a metal salt; and R2 represents hydrogen, acetoxy methyl, (2,5-dihydro-2-methyl-6-hydroxy-5-oxo-as-triazin-3-yl)thiomethyl or (1-methyl-1-H-tetrazol-5-yl)thiomethyl is disclosed. This process comprises the steps of (a) reacting triphenylphosphine and hexachloroethane or carbon tetrachloride with 2-(2-aminothiazol-4-yl)-2-syn-methoxyimino acetic acid in an organic solvent to give the corresponding acyloxyphosphonium chloride derivative of the formula: (b) acylating a previously silylated derivative of 7-ACA with this acyloxyphosphonium chloride derivative without its isolation. |
